在数字化时代,无论是学生、职场新人还是专业人士,撰写报告、文档都是一项基本技能。而Markdown作为一种轻量级的标记语言,因其简洁、易学、高效的特点,成为了文档制作的理想选择。本文将为你详细介绍Markdown的基本用法和高级技巧,让你轻松上手,高效制作专业文档。
基础语法介绍
1. 标题
Markdown使用#来创建标题,#的数量决定了标题的层级。例如:
# 一级标题
## 二级标题
### 三级标题
2. 段落与换行
直接输入文本即可创建段落,段落之间需要空行来区分。换行则可以在行尾添加两个空格。
3. 强调
使用星号*或下划线_来表示文本的强调:
*斜体*
**粗体**
4. 列表
使用-、+或*来创建无序列表,使用数字和句点创建有序列表:
- 无序列表1
- 无序列表2
- 无序列表3
1. 有序列表1
2. 有序列表2
3. 有序列表3
5. 链接与图片
链接使用[描述](链接地址)格式,图片则使用格式:
[这是一个链接](http://example.com)

6. 引用
使用>来创建引用:
> 这是一个引用
7. 表格
表格使用竖线|来分隔列,使用-来分隔行:
| 表头1 | 表头2 | 表头3 |
| --- | --- | --- |
| 内容1 | 内容2 | 内容3 |
| 内容4 | 内容5 | 内容6 |
高级技巧
1. 代码块
Markdown支持多种编程语言的代码块,使用三个反引号`来创建:
```python
print("Hello, World!")
### 2. 分隔线
使用三个或更多短横线、星号或下划线来创建分隔线:
```markdown
---
***
3. 任务列表
使用- [ ]或- [x]来创建任务列表:
- [ ] 任务1
- [ ] 任务2
- [x] 任务3
4. 脚注
使用[^1]来创建脚注,并在文档底部添加相应的解释:
这是一个脚注[^1]。
[^1]: 脚注内容
实战案例
假设你是一位项目经理,需要制作一份项目进度报告。以下是如何使用Markdown来创建这份报告的示例:
”`markdown
项目进度报告
项目概述
本项目旨在开发一款智能移动应用,满足用户在生活、工作等方面的需求。
项目进度
- [x] 需求分析
- [ ] 设计方案
- [ ] 编码开发
- [ ] 测试与优化
团队成员
| 姓名 | 角色 |
|---|---|
| 张三 | 项目经理 |
| 李四 | 产品经理 |
| 王五 | 开发工程师 |
下一步计划
- 完成设计方案
- 开始编码开发
注意:以上内容仅为示例,具体内容请根据实际情况进行调整。
总结
通过学习Markdown的基础语法和高级技巧,你将能够轻松制作出专业、美观的文档。无论是工作汇报、学习笔记还是个人博客,Markdown都能为你提供强大的支持。让我们一起探索Markdown的更多可能性,让文档制作变得更加简单、高效!
